WebJun 9, 2015 · The order q of the Hill number determines the weighting given to more common species, with species richness defined by q=0. Other Hill numbers are the exponential Shannon index (q=1), and the ... WebJul 12, 2024 · In addition, Hill numbers (Hill 1973) and the analysis of their properties and scope done by Jost have become widely used and applied. This measure of diversity ( q D, named true diversity sensu Jost 2006 ) can have different orders (so-called order q) according to the importance given to species abundances.
